MORTAL KOMBAT 11: AFTERMATH - RoboCop And The Terminator Are Pitted Against Each Other In Awesome New Trailer

If you are one of those movie buffs that grew up in the 80s and 90s, you probably asked yourself who would win in a fight between RoboCop and Terminator; a fairly reasonable question, considering that RoboCop and Terminator were all people would talk about when it came to action movie characters.

NetherRealm Studios already announced and added Terminator to Mortal Kombat 11, as one of the fighters via the game's Kombat Pack, and will see RoboCop joining the game via the Aftermath expansion set to release on Tuesday next week — which will allow fans of the characters to finally answer their question.

In case you don't own the Kombat Pack, and are still not too convinced about Mortal Kombat 11: Aftermath, NetherRealm Studios has decided to finally pit RoboCop and the Terminator against each other; sharing two action-packed gameplay videos that see both iconic characters duking it out.

These two new gameplay videos also give us a chance to see more gameplay of RoboCop ahead of his debut in Mortal Kombat 11: Aftermath, and it really looks like the developers managed to give RoboCop a solid set of movements based on Paul Verhoeven's film.

RoboCop was quite the heavy character in the movies and we never really saw him run or jump, but the people over at NetherRealm Studios made sure to give him a proper set of moves that make him a deadly zoner. On May 26th the epic saga continues with Mortal Kombat 11: Aftermath! This new entry expands the critically acclaimed story campaign of Mortal Kombat 11 with an all-new cinematic narrative centered around trust and deceit. Joining the fight will be Mortal Kombat alumni, Fujin and Sheeva, and guest character, RoboCop, making his series debut!

Mortal Kombat 11: Aftermath will release for the PlayStation 4, Nintendo Switch, Xbox One, and PC on the 26th of May.
